Steel Hawk files suit over alleged misappropriation


PETALING JAYA: Steel Hawk Bhd has initiated legal proceedings against five parties, alleging breaches of a collaboration agreement and misappropriation of funds linked to engineering projects for Tenaga Nasional Bhd (TNB).

In a bourse filing yesterday, the group said its wholly owned subsidiary, Steel Hawk Engineering Sdn Bhd (SHESB), had filed a writ of summons and statement of claim at the High Court in Kuala Lumpur.

The defendants are Ibrahim & Sons Engineering Sdn Bhd (IBSE), Always Ahead Engineering Sdn Bhd, and three individuals.

The dispute stems from a collaboration agreement dated July 31, 2025, under which IBSE was appointed as the main contractor while SHESB provided funding and working capital in return for repayment and profit-sharing.

The agreement stipulated that all payments received from TNB were to be held in designated trust or escrow accounts.
